GLP-1-based weight-loss medications can make meals smaller, hunger quieter, and daily food intake noticeably different. For people in Fort Myers, that raises a practical nutrition question: if you are eating much less than before, are you still getting enough protein, vitamins, minerals, and fluids? The answer is not that everyone using these medications becomes deficient. A more useful approach is to watch how your intake changes and decide whether dietary review or targeted testing makes sense for you.

What the 2026 research actually found

A 24-week CRAVE study followed 28 adults with obesity who started semaglutide or tirzepatide in a real-world setting without structured nutrition intervention. Participants lost weight and fat mass, and their total energy and macronutrient intake fell significantly. Intake also declined across several micronutrients, including magnesium, potassium, iron, zinc, copper, selenium, folate, vitamin B6, niacin, and pantothenic acid. Diet quality did not significantly improve during the study. Only 28 participants were included, and attrition limited follow-up, so the results do not show what will happen to every person using these medications.

A separate 2026 micronutrient review evaluated six studies involving 480,825 adults. Across those studies, the authors found recurring concerns involving vitamin D, iron status, calcium intake, vitamin B12, and other nutrients. Most included data were observational, so causation between therapy and the reported nutritional abnormalities was not established.

The studies do not show that every GLP-1 user will become deficient. A person may eat less because appetite is lower, portions shrink, or gastrointestinal symptoms make food less appealing. Lower intake can make nutritional needs harder to cover, especially when the diet was already limited. The practical question is whether eating patterns, symptoms, history, or laboratory results suggest a reason to look closer.

Why eating less can change nutrient intake

Calories and micronutrients are not the same thing, yet they often move together when someone eats less overall. A smaller amount of food can still be nutrient-dense. Meals can be built around protein-rich foods, produce, whole grains or other fiber-rich foods, and appropriate sources of vitamins and minerals. Risk can rise when intake falls sharply. A narrow range of remaining foods can make nutrient coverage harder. Food quality therefore matters alongside the number on the scale.

Medication effects can add another layer. Current FDA prescribing information for semaglutide used for weight management lists nausea, diarrhea, vomiting, constipation, abdominal pain, and other gastrointestinal reactions among common adverse effects, and it notes that the medication delays gastric emptying. Early fullness or ongoing nausea may lead someone to skip meals or rely on a few tolerated foods. Repeated vomiting or diarrhea can also make hydration and intake harder to maintain. Persistent or severe symptoms deserve medical attention rather than a nutrition workaround alone.

The medication is only one part of the picture. Someone may begin treatment with low vitamin D, low iron stores, a restrictive eating pattern, or another nutrition concern that was already present. A change detected later does not automatically show what caused it. Baseline context can make follow-up results much easier to interpret.

Who may benefit from a closer nutrition review

A dietary review can be reasonable when portions become very small or meals are frequently skipped. Narrowing food variety for weeks can be another reason to review the pattern. Nausea, vomiting, constipation, diarrhea, or early fullness can also change what you comfortably eat. The goal is to understand the pattern before jumping to a supplement. A short food and symptom record gives a clinician useful context. That context can be more informative than a list of vitamins taken at random.

Some people have a stronger reason for targeted laboratory monitoring. The 2026 literature highlights higher concern in people with prior bariatric surgery, gastrointestinal disorders, poor baseline diet quality, older age, or prolonged nausea and vomiting, and a previous deficiency can add useful context. Symptoms such as unusual fatigue, weakness, dizziness, numbness, or other changes can have many causes, so they should not be self-diagnosed as a nutrient problem. A clinician can decide whether the history points toward testing and which tests are relevant. Testing should be individualized rather than ordered as a one-size-fits-all panel.

Rapid or substantial weight loss may also prompt a broader look at food intake, protein, physical function, and body composition. The small CRAVE cohort found that estimated skeletal muscle mass declined with body weight, while higher absolute protein intake was associated with greater preservation of estimated skeletal muscle mass. That association does not establish one protein prescription for every patient. It supports discussing protein intake and resistance exercise as part of medical weight management.

What micronutrient testing can and cannot tell you

Micronutrient testing is most useful when there is a specific clinical question. A clinician may consider symptoms, diet, prior laboratory results, medications, medical conditions, and recent weight loss before deciding what to check. Depending on the situation, that conversation could involve iron status, vitamin B12, vitamin D, or other nutrients identified by the history. More testing is not automatically better. A targeted approach keeps testing tied to the person’s overall picture.

Current research does not establish one universal micronutrient panel or testing interval for every person using GLP-1-based weight-loss medication. The 2026 reviews instead call for individualized nutritional assessment and targeted laboratory evaluation in people at higher risk. That distinction matters for someone who feels well and eats a varied diet, as well as for someone whose appetite has fallen so far that meeting basic nutrition needs is difficult.

Laboratory results need context. A low or borderline value may call for dietary changes, oral supplementation, additional evaluation, or another plan depending on the nutrient and the reason it is low. A normal result does not mean diet quality can be ignored. Follow-up should connect the numbers with food intake, symptoms, and treatment progress.

Practical priorities while losing weight

A joint nutrition advisory from four professional organizations recommends baseline nutrition assessment, nutrient-dense eating, management of gastrointestinal side effects, adequate protein, and strength-focused activity during GLP-1 therapy for obesity. In everyday terms, that means protecting food quality when appetite is smaller. Protein-rich foods can be spread across meals rather than left for the end of the day. Fruits, vegetables, whole grains, beans, dairy or suitable alternatives, and other nutrient-dense foods can be chosen according to tolerance and medical needs.

Hydration deserves attention too, especially when nausea, vomiting, diarrhea, or constipation is present. Small, regular sips may be easier for some people than trying to drink a large amount at once, but fluid needs vary with health conditions, medications, activity, and weather. People with conditions that affect fluid needs should follow individualized medical advice. Severe or persistent gastrointestinal symptoms should be reported to the prescribing clinician. Nutrition strategies should support medical care, not delay it.

Weight management should not become a race to eat as little as possible. A smaller meal can still emphasize nutrient density, and resistance exercise can support physical function during weight loss. Sleep, activity, medication tolerance, and the ability to prepare or obtain nourishing food can all influence what is realistic. Medical follow-up creates a place to adjust the plan as those factors change.

A 7-Day Nutrition Check-In to Bring With You

A short log can make a nutrition review more specific without turning every meal into a math problem. Use the notes below for about a week and bring them to your appointment to make patterns easier to discuss.

What to track Simple example Why it helps the visit
Meal size and skipped meals “Ate about half my usual lunch; skipped dinner twice.” Shows how much intake has changed in real life.
Protein-containing foods Eggs, fish, chicken, yogurt, tofu, beans, or another regular source. Helps identify whether smaller meals still contain a protein source.
Food variety Note fruits, vegetables, grains, dairy or alternatives, and other staple foods. Highlights whether the diet has narrowed to only a few tolerated foods.
Fluids Approximate water and other beverages across the day. Adds context when gastrointestinal symptoms or low intake are present.
Gastrointestinal symptoms Record nausea, vomiting, diarrhea, constipation, or very early fullness. Shows whether symptoms are changing when and what you eat.
Supplements and medications List names, doses, and how often you take them. Gives the clinician a fuller picture before recommending anything new.

Where vitamin injections may fit

Vitamin injections are not an automatic companion to GLP-1 weight loss. Clinical appropriateness depends on the nutrient, symptoms and history, laboratory findings when relevant, and whether diet or oral supplementation can reasonably address the issue. A measured deficiency may require a different plan from low dietary intake without a confirmed deficiency. The route, dose, and follow-up should match the clinical situation. Extra nutrient intake does not correct the underlying quality of the diet.

This is where medical weight loss and micronutrient testing can connect without creating a treatment need that is not there. A patient whose intake is varied and whose evaluation shows no concern may not need added nutrient treatment. A person with a documented issue may instead benefit from a targeted plan chosen by the clinician. The aim is to match support to the individual rather than assume every person on a GLP-1-based medication needs the same add-on.

Four common questions about GLP-1s and nutrients

Do GLP-1 medications automatically cause vitamin deficiencies?

No. The 2026 data show associations between GLP-1-based treatment, lower food intake, and several nutrition concerns, but they do not prove that every user will become deficient or that the medication directly causes every abnormal result. Baseline diet, medical history, gastrointestinal symptoms, and the amount and variety of food eaten all matter. Individual evaluation is more useful than assuming a deficiency is present.

Should everyone get micronutrient testing before or during treatment?

There is no established universal panel or testing schedule for every GLP-1 user. Targeted testing is more reasonable when symptoms, prior deficiencies, restrictive intake, relevant medical history, or other risk factors raise a clinical question. Your clinician can decide what to test and when based on that context.

Which nutrients are showing up most often in the research?

Recent studies and reviews have raised concerns involving vitamin D, iron, calcium, vitamin B12, magnesium, zinc, and several other vitamins and minerals. The small CRAVE study measured declines in dietary intake of multiple nutrients, while the larger 2026 review found recurring abnormalities across different datasets. Those findings are signals for nutrition awareness, not a checklist proving that every patient lacks each nutrient. Testing and treatment should follow the individual situation.

Can a vitamin injection replace attention to food quality?

No. An injection may be appropriate for a specific nutrient in a specific person, but it does not replace the broader need for adequate protein, fluids, and a varied nutrient-dense diet. Food intake also affects fiber and many other components a single injection cannot supply, so a targeted plan should address the reason a nutrient problem developed rather than only the replacement route.
